Labour's poor election results have sparked speculation about Keir Starmer's future as prime minister, but Attorney General Heidi Alexander has moved to reassure the party by insisting he can survive a leadership challenge. The statement comes as Labour faces mounting pressure following disappointing performances in recent votes. Alexander's public backing suggests the government is working to project unity and stability amid internal uncertainty. The comments reflect deeper tensions within the party over Starmer's leadership in the wake of electoral setbacks.
